DIY Remedies for Dry Hair

DIY REMEDIES FOR DRY HAIR

The winter months can wreak havoc on even the healthiest of hair. To prevent the dreaded dry, parched strands that come with snow, hats, and wintertime, try our cheap and easy DIY tips.

1. Start With Your Scalp
Warm up some good old-fashioned castor oil and massage it onto your scalp. Keeping your scalp healthy and moisturized can make a huge difference with your hair.

2. Eat Right
Your hair needs healthy minerals and vitamins to stay strong and conditioned, so fill your diet with fruits like bananas and apples and vegetables like carrots, pumpkin, and spinach. All these foods contain hair-health-friendly vitamin A. And don’t forget to drink plenty of water!

3. Olive Oil and Honey Mask
Create a hydrating hair mask using ingredients you probably already have in your kitchen. Mix ½ cup of honey with 1 to 2 tablespoons of olive oil and apply to damp hair.
